Divorce, marriage, a new job, a death in the family, attending college for the first time are some the life changes we experience in life. When we are in the verge of a life transition, sometimes we feel like we need something to do make things stable. Because of the confusion of this life transition, cult finds these time a great season to their recruitment effort since at this point in time we are more vulnerable.
Since a person is very vulnerable at this struggling time, the cultist makes a move to entice this person. Once the cultist sees that the person becomes interested and dependent on his counsel, then the cultist takes this opportunity to involve one to the cult.
